Barron Williams Executive Search is seeking a part-time Director of Finance & Corporate Services in North East England. The successful candidate will provide strategic oversight and lead core business functions within a dedicated not-for-profit organization supporting the energy sector.

This role requires an experienced finance leader with a qualified accountant background who can engage stakeholders and contribute to strategic direction. The position offers an attractive pro-rata salary, benefits, and an opportunity to make a significant impact.
